"Seeing Red" is the fourth episode of the American television miniseries ''Ms. Marvel (miniseries), Ms. Marvel'', based on Marvel Comics featuring the character Kamala Khan, Ms. Marvel. It follows Kamala Khan (Marvel Cinematic Universe), Kamala Khan as she travels to Karachi, Pakistan to learn more about her mysterious bangle. The episode is set in the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U), sharing continuity with List of Marvel Cinematic Universe films, the films of the franchise. It was written by Sabir Pirzada, A. C. Bradley (screenwriter), A. C. Bradley, and Matthew Chauncey, with a story by Pirzada. The episode was directed by Sharmeen Obaid-Chinoy. Iman Vellani stars as Kamala Khan, alongside Zenobia Shroff, Rish Shah, Samina Ahmad, Fawad Khan, Nimra Bucha, Mehwish Hayat, Adaku Ononogbo, Farhan Akhtar, and Aramis Knight. Sharmeen Obaid-Chinoy
Sharmeen Obaid-Chinoy (; born November 12, 1978) is a Pakistani journalist, filmmaker and political activist known for her work in films that highlight gender inequality against women. Obaid-Chinoy is slated to direct an upcoming ''Star Wars'' film, which is set to feature a returning Daisy Ridley as Rey. Early life and education Obaid-Chinoy was born on 12 November 1978 in Karachi, Pakistan. Obaid-Chinoy is a Gujarati Muslim, her mother Saba Obaid is a social worker and her father Sheikh Obaid, was a businessman. She has four younger sisters, including Mahjabeen Obaid, and a younger brother. Obaid-Chinoy attended Convent of Jesus and Mary, followed by schooling at Karachi Grammar School, where she was a class-fellow of Kumail Nanjiani. According to her, she was not inclined toward academics though received good grades. She asked many questions about the world, so her mother suggested that she put her questions in writing.
